A Brush with Kindness Home Repair, Santa Barbara


On Saturday, December 10th a group of volunteers celebrating a 30th birthday spent the day clearing brush for fire safety, removing a broken fence surrounding the property, and landscaping the front and back of the house as part of Habitat's "A Brush with Kindness" home repair program. The repairs took place at the home of Ann, an 82-year-old widowed homeowner who has lived in her home in the foothills of Santa Barbara for 59 years.  
 
Due to the home's proximity to the fire zone, Habitat consulted with the county fire department to learn what brush and vegetation on the property should be cleared to protect both the home and homeowner. Fire resistant plants were also replanted thanks to generous donations provided by Seven Day Nursery and Island Seed and Feed.
